FitzSimmins Surname Meaning

From Where Does The Surname Originate? meaning and history

This family came from England to Leinster in 1323; IF 291; MIF 257; Map Wmea

A Guide to Irish Names (1964) by Edward MacLysaght

How Common Is The Last Name FitzSimmins? popularity and diffusion

It is the 3,882,373rd most common surname globally. It is borne by approximately 1 in 280,290,228 people. This surname occurs mostly in The Americas, where 77 percent of FitzSimmins reside; 77 percent reside in North America and 77 percent reside in Anglo-North America.

The surname is most frequently held in Canada, where it is borne by 19 people, or 1 in 1,939,242. In Canada FitzSimmins is most prevalent in: Ontario, where 79 percent are found and British Columbia, where 21 percent are found. Other than Canada this last name exists in 3 countries. It is also common in Northern Ireland, where 19 percent are found and England, where 4 percent are found.

FitzSimmins Family Population Trend historical fluctuation

The incidence of FitzSimmins has changed through the years. In The United States the share of the population with the last name fell 94 percent between 1880 and 2014.

FitzSimmins Last Name Statistics demography

The religious adherence of those bearing the FitzSimmins last name is principally Presbyterian (83%) in Ireland.

FitzSimmins earn somewhat more than the average income. In Canada they earn 10.12% more than the national average, earning $54,712 CAD per year.
